589: Ryan Salts on Removing the "Passion Blinders" to get Perspective

from Restaurant Unstoppable with Eric Cacciatore

Hailing from San Antonio and graduate of  St. Mary's University with a BBA in Accounting, Ryan Salts' experience includes working at the 80/20 Foundation and Geekdom prior to helping open Launch SA (formerly Café Commerce). Through Launch SA, Ryan created many of the programs now operating, including Break Fast & Launch, Pitch Tab and San Antonio Entrepreneurship Week.  His greatest value is his network and helping provide opportunities for entrepreneurs to create valuable connections. Show notes… Favorite success quote or mantra: Every day is a new day.
